Subject: Seatline cut-over complete

The new seat-map renderer for the Gildenmoor Playhouse went live overnight. Legacy canvas rendering is fully retired; all tiers, boxes, and the restored balcony now draw from the vector service. No booking interruptions were observed during the switch. For the release record, the renderer launched with the configuration values shown below.

service settings:
[casax]
port = 6379
team = rusir
host = casax.zemvarhq.corp
region = outer-4
access_code = ac_9808ce
timeout_ms = 1500

- [ ] **Step 7: Breaker override escrow.** After sealing the signing keys for the Tallgrove upstream API circuit breaker, confirm the support team can force the breaker open during a full outage. The override bundle lives in the sealed escrow drawer and is useless without its unlock phrase. Two ceremony witnesses must initial this step before proceeding. The escrow bundle is decrypted with the recovery passphrase that follows.

vault phrase of kahip-kahop = holath-quenmir

## Turnstile Upgrade — Delvanto House Lobby

Heads up, assistants: the old clunky turnstiles are being swapped for speed gates this fortnight. Staff badges will work as normal once your team re-registers at the security desk. Guests still need day passes, so book them in early — the new gates won't accept paper slips. If the gates fault and security is away, staff can use the override keypad with the code below.

door code, bagef-yafop: bdg-ZFZML-07646

Hey team — quick handover before I'm out. Marit and I finished the role-based access rollout on the Quillbase wiki. Editors are now scoped per space, and the old global-admin group is deprecated (don't re-add people to it, please). One gotcha: the permissions sync job occasionally stalls and needs a manual kick from the admin CLI. To unlock the CLI's recovery mode you'll need the admin passphrase, which is:

vault phrase of bagaf-kajeg = jorath-feniel-briir-siliel-ralix

Action item from the Bramleaf checkout outage review: our load tests never exercised the coupon-validation path above 200 rps, so the Tollgate gateway queue limits were never validated. Please review the updated load profile in the harness config. The revised tuning constants for the test rig are as follows.

tuning table, faduf-baduf:
PRIORITIES = {
    "ulavan": 191,
    "silys": 750,
    "goriel": 238,
    "kelmir": 66,
    "wendor": 432,
}